About Otomin

Quiet streets, close-in suburban pace.

Otomin moves at an unhurried pace, shaped by Otomin Lake and quiet streets where daily life feels close at hand, giving the area a calm, distinctly local rhythm.

03 / 07
Is Otomin walkable, or will I need a car?
You can walk for short local outings, but a car or ride service is usually the easiest way to move around Otomin. Stays here suit travelers who want a quieter base and do not mind planning ahead for meals, errands, or time in nearby areas. Check the listing for parking or transit details, since these can vary by building.
